No Leads - Small pipeline for entire sales team

Hey,


Like the title suggest - our entire sales team is behind on quota for the past 2 months. There aren't enough inbounds or leads set by SDR Team. There is a big push for outbound efforts - What would be the most effective/scalable outbound strategy for a mid-market saas product? The average deal size is around 5k and can close in under a month.


Bulk cold emailing? Vidyard? The industry is not active on linkedin.

Run a monthly sales contest for AEs to create their own Leads. This will incentivize them to go hunt on their own. It will also show you what is possible from the top performer and leverage that success as a training opportunity for the SDRs.

Don’t let AEs complain about no leads! Make them go out and get them, themselves!!

Each AE needs to be responsible for their own pipeline. I don’t know how you all are segmented out - by industry, geographically, etc but I would personally take the time to analyze my territory, dive deep into who my target market is, retool my script and start smiling/ dialing. Email is a waste. Vidyard is too. You can’t blame SDRs or mngt. You can only blame yourselves if your funnel is full.

It will be a volume game in the end, along with having a razor sharp prospecting message. Don’t forget people buy because of pain, loss, or risk and it needs to tie to “why now”

If each AE has a specific territory (vertical, geo, what have you) they should have a territory plan and have key accounts in their region that they would like to target. AEs should start calling their prospects, and mix it up with email. I think videos are a waste of time. By the time you've recorded one, you could have made several calls or emails.

Could you provide more context ?

What problems are you solving? For whom? With what solution? Given ACV, is there a self served version ? What’s the sales process?

Without this basic context, you’ll get generic if not conflicting advices…

18 touhcpoint cadence, semi-auto:
• in + e-mail + call
• Semi-auto only
• Gated at 10 new leads activated per day (make sure to import perfect lists monthly at Day 0)

targeted copy
• avg. 143 tasks per day, 180 at most per day
• Sales engagement generates tasks, don't use people's time, please! (Hubspot workflows, Reev, Apollo Sequences or something else)

Make sure you have the right ICP or look into why it may have changed. Did the economy heavily impact your target personas more than others? Are you reps talking about the wrong initiatives at the target company?
